Overview

As the Senior Compensation Analyst, you will be responsible for aligning compensation processes and programs with business objectives, providing analytical expertise and business support for Solidigm’s global workforce.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ree required.
  • 5 to 7 years of experience in compensation or analytical fields.
  • Exceptional quantitative and analytical skills.
  • Advanced Excel modeling skills; Macro knowledge is a plus.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ects with limited guidance.
  • CCP or related designation preferred.
  • Workday experience preferred.

Solidigm

Solidigm is a multibillion-dollar global leader in the memory industry, headquartered in Rancho Cordova, California. The company merges the stability of an established technology firm with the agility and entrepreneurial spirit of a start-up. With a strong international presence across Asia, Europe, and the Americas, Solidigm is committed to innovating new memory technologies and aims to become the world's top NAND memory company.
